1. The War of the Oaken Bucket (1325)

What began as a petty quarrel over a stolen wooden bucket erupted into a fierce war between the rival Italian city-states of Modena and Bologna. This peculiar conflict, known as the War of the Oaken Bucket, saw thousands clash in battle, underscoring the intense rivalries and fragile alliances that defined medieval Italy. The outcome shifted regional power and set the stage for future conflicts among Italy’s fractious communes.
